Overview

Queen Creek is a midsize city in the state of Arizona with a population of 57,728. Queen Creek has a desert hot and dry climate. The presence of parks and green space will enable you to spend time in the outdoors

Social and Economic Statistics of Queen Creek, AZ

Employment and Income Queen Creek Arizona United States
Per Capita Income $42,634 $26,531 $32,693
Median Household Income $111,743 $53,305 $65,483
Unemployment Rate 5.4% 9.3% 5.7%
Poverty Rate 3.5% 16.7% 10.5%
